oracle数据库全库备份语句
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
oracle数据库全库备份语句
Oracle数据库是一种关系型数据库管理系统,提供了全库备份的功能,可以用来备份整个数据库。
下面列举了10个不同的Oracle数据库全库备份语句。
1. 使用RMAN备份全库:
使用RMAN工具备份整个Oracle数据库,可以使用以下命令:
```
RMAN> backup database;
```
2. 使用expdp备份全库:
使用expdp工具备份整个Oracle数据库,可以使用以下命令:
```
expdp system/password@database_name full=Y directory=backup_dir dumpfile=full_backup.dmp logfile=full_backup.log;
```
3. 使用exp备份全库:
使用exp工具备份整个Oracle数据库,可以使用以下命令:
```
exp system/password@database_name full=y file=full_backup.dmp log=full_backup.log;
4. 使用Data Pump备份全库:
使用Data Pump工具备份整个Oracle数据库,可以使用以下命令:
```
expdp system/password@database_name full=Y directory=backup_dir dumpfile=full_backup.dmp logfile=full_backup.log;
```
5. 使用RMAN增量备份全库:
使用RMAN工具进行增量备份,可以使用以下命令:
```
RMAN> backup incremental level 1 cumulative database;
```
6. 使用expdp表空间备份:
使用expdp工具备份指定表空间的数据,可以使用以下命令:
```
expdp system/password@database_name tablespaces=tablespace_name directory=backup_dir dumpfile=tablespace_backup.dmp
logfile=tablespace_backup.log;
7. 使用exp表空间备份:
使用exp工具备份指定表空间的数据,可以使用以下命令:
```
exp system/password@database_name tablespaces=tablespace_name file=tablespace_backup.dmp log=tablespace_backup.log;
```
8. 使用RMAN备份控制文件和参数文件:
使用RMAN工具备份控制文件和参数文件,可以使用以下命令:
```
RMAN> backup current controlfile;
```
9. 使用expdp备份指定用户的数据:
使用expdp工具备份指定用户的数据,可以使用以下命令:
```
expdp system/password@database_name schemas=user_name directory=backup_dir dumpfile=user_backup.dmp logfile=user_backup.log;
```
10. 使用exp备份指定用户的数据:
使用exp工具备份指定用户的数据,可以使用以下命令:
```
exp system/password@database_name owner=user_name file=user_backup.dmp log=user_backup.log;
```
以上是10个不同的Oracle数据库全库备份语句,可以根据实际需求选择合适的备份方式进行数据库备份。
使用这些备份语句可以有效地保护数据库的完整性和可恢复性。